After sharing the 'My Music' folder with another user on my computer, it somehow got removed off my start menu. I can still access it through the 'My Documents' folder, but the link is no longer there. 'My Documents, My Pictures, and My Computer are still there, just not 'My Music'. It's checked to be on my start menu in the customize the start menu options. But it's not on there, can anyone help me out?

Dude, try this. Do a right click on your start button
and select properties. Then click on the Advanced tab and
scroll through the Start Menu Items, see if the My Music
option has been set to "Don't display this item." That
should do it.
